roll information: On Friday Labor asked the Australian federal police to investigate whether Tim Wilson inappropriately shared electoral roll information for commercial purposes while campaigning against the opposition's franking credit policy, according to The Guardian. The referral was based on a Fairfax Media report that a constituent of Wilson's received material both from the Liberal MP and from Wilson Asset Management, the funds management company chaired by Geoff Wilson, after responding to a robopoll. Late on Friday Geoff Wilson issued a statement clarifying his involvement in after a growing controversy over whether the pair who are first cousins once-removed have inappropriately politicised the parliamentary inquiry. Tim Wilson, who chairs the House economics committee and is also a shareholder in funds managed by Wilson Asset Management, has denied any wrongdoing, telling Guardian Australia he had not shared any voter's private information from the electoral roll with Wilson Asset Management . PM says he won't sack Tim Wilson over use of franking credits inquiry Read more The Fairfax Media report quoted a resident of the Melbourne suburb of Brighton, Gwen Woodford, who said she had answered yes to a robocall from Tim Wilson, and later received multiple emails promoting Wilson Asset Management funds . Labor MP Matt Thistlethwaite, the deputy chair of the committee, wrote to the AFP commissioner, Andrew Colvin, on Friday arguing the report suggested Tim Wilson had obtained private information from the Commonwealth electoral roll and disclosed it to Wilson Asset Management to allow it to market its financial products to voters.
